For Ashe the players MUST use well with Ashe's range + volley. Autoattack + volley combo is important for you to win any trades. Back off right away if the enemy is champion such as Ezreal, Corki, or MF as they will outdamage you, however, your slow will stop them from keep chasing you most of the time, unless they put themselves in much greater risk
Flash + Cleanse should be able to let you escape most situation when you position properly, if the enemy have blitz, put a sightward into the bush, and use advantage of your 600 autoattack range to poke the enemy (graves have only 525 range, for example.)
Overall Ashe is a really basic AD carry that is really rewarding via good position and useage of ultimate. While she is basic it doesn't means she is easy. It is recommended to start by playing Caitlyn then transition into play Ashe.
